概括
子宫内膜异位症可能会对卵子 (卵子细胞) 质量产生负面影响,可能会影响生育能力和体外受精 (IVF) 成功率. 需要进一步的研究来了解这些影响并改进治疗方法.

背景情况:
- 子宫内膜异位症影响全球10%的生育年龄妇女,导致骨盆疼痛和不孕.
- 众所周知,它会影响卵细胞质量,这对受精和怀孕至关重要.
- 将子宫内膜异位与卵细胞功能障碍联系在一起的精确机制需要进一步阐明.
研究的目的:
- 审查目前关于子宫内膜异位症如何影响卵细胞质量的证据.
- 检查后续对生育结果的影响,特别是在体外受精 (IVF) 中.
主要方法:
- 在PubMed.com进行全面的文献搜索.
- 关键词:"子宫内膜异位症和卵细胞质量"",子宫内膜异位症和不孕症"",子宫内膜异位症和试管婴儿".
- 包括到2024年7月发表的研究.
主要成果:
- 子宫内膜异位症与卵细胞质量降低有关,表现出形态和分子异常.
- 这些缺陷可能导致更低的受精率,胚胎发育受损,妊娠成功率降低.
- 一些证据表明,当控制年龄和卵巢储备等因素时,IVF结果可比.
结论:
- 了解子宫内膜异位症对卵细胞质量的影响对于改善生育治疗至关重要.
- 辅助生殖技术和个性化方法可能有助于减轻不良影响.
- 人工智能为客观的卵细胞质量评估提供了一个潜在的未来工具.
